Born on January 3, 1968, in Baku, Azerbaijan, is a distinguished academic in the field of geography. She graduated from the Faculty of Geography at Baku State University.
In 1993, she began her career at the Azerbaijan State University of Economics (UNEC) in the “ASC” Department and, in 1994, transitioned to the “Geography” Department as a senior laboratory assistant. Since 1995, she has been a doctoral candidate at the department.

In 1999, Dr. Asgarova was appointed as a part-time lecturer, and in 2000, she became a full-time lecturer. The same year, she defended her candidate dissertation and was awarded the title of Candidate of Geographical Sciences (Ph.D.).
In 2007, she was promoted to the position of Senior Lecturer. She has authored 14 scientific articles, 2 methodological guides, 1 textbook (authored the 8th section), and 2 programs.
Currently, Mehriban Asgarova serves as an Associate Professor in the “Environmental Protection and Economics” Department at UNEC.
